There are numerous types of residential windows offered, each offering special advantages. Below is a comprehensive list of typical window designs:

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. The length of time does window installation take?
The time needed for window installation can vary based on the variety of windows being installed and the complexity of the task. Typically, it can take anywhere from a few hours to a number of days.
2. Do I require a license for window installation?
In many areas, an authorization is needed for window installation, especially if the task involves structural changes. It's recommended to check local regulations.
3. How do I know if I require to replace my windows?
Signs that may show the requirement for replacement consist of drafts, problem opening or closing the windows, cracked or decaying frames, and high energy expenses.
4. What should I anticipate during the installation procedure?
Property owners can expect some sound and disturbance throughout the installation procedure. Nevertheless, professional installers typically aim to minimize hassle.
5. Can I install windows myself?
While DIY installation is possible, hiring a professional is recommended for correct fitting, insulation, and sealing, especially given the financial investment involved.
